A nurse is caring for an elderly client who is to undergo a brief mental status examination as part of psychometric testing. What function is lost in the initial stages of Alzheimer's disease (AD)?
 
  A) Memory of childhood events
  B) Ability to complete simple tasks
  C) Ability to concentrate
  D) Ability to remember everyday words

Feedback:
A client in the initial stages of AD loses the ability to concentrate. Concentration and orientation are affected initially in a client with AD. Memory of recent events, not long-ago events, are lost first in AD. The client developing AD would first lose the ability to complete complex tasks, not simple tasks. Deteriorating language skills, such as difficulty to remember everyday words, occurs later during the progression of the disease and not initially.
